====Pokémon Brilliant Diamond and Shining Pearl====
In [[Pokémon Brilliant Diamond and Shining Pearl]], if the player has seen the all of {{OBP|Pokémon|species}} in the [[List of Pokémon by Sinnoh Pokédex number|Sinnoh Pokédex]] (excluding [[Manaphy (Pokémon)|Manaphy]]), they can obtain the National Pokédex, which only includes the first 493 Pokémon, introduced from [[Generation I]]-[[Generation IV]]. If the player has met the appropriate condition and talks to [[Professor Rowan]] in his lab in [[Sandgem Town]], [[Professor Oak]] will arrive and upgrade the player's [[Pokédex]] with the National Mode.

====Pokémon Legends: Arceus====
[[Pokémon Legends: Arceus]] does not include the National Pokédex. Only Pokémon in the Hisui Pokédex can be used in Pokémon Legends: Arceus.
